		<description>Feed your dog a few scraps on the dry food, then phase that out. I always feed my dogs after my husband and I have eaten...Pack leaders eat first. Then after you eat, feed the dog. The dog will be salivating after smelling what you ate, so he will probably eat without much prompting. I had to retrain my dogs also. Just feed them at the same time everyday, if possible. Then pick the food bowl up off the floor when they finish. Leaving the bowl down all day is what spoiled my pets. It may take him a few days, but I promise you he will eat when he gets hungry, no matter what it is!</description>

		<description>Fill his bowl with dry dog food, then when you and your family eat DO NOT give him scraps at the table. Instead, put the scraps on top of his food, then mix it in with the dry dog food. That way he will have to eat the dog food to get to the tasty table scraps. Keep doing this and you will modify his behavior. Dogs always want to eat someone else&#039;s food first before they will go to their boring old bowl of Purina.</description>
